ToeJam & Earl Back In The Groove delayed to 2018!







On November 7, Adult Swim published on their Youtube channel that ToeJam & Earl Back in the Groove will be available for Consoles and PC in 2017. At the end of the video, you can see the duo tease the viewer and rephrase that it will be out in 2018, though no exact date is given. The game is based on the original released in 1991 for the Sega Genesis/Megadrive and is now widely available for all regions on the Playstation Network for PS3 only, Xbox Live for Xbox 360 Only and PC by Steam. (Also was available on Wiishop virtual console)

The new game is developed by HumaNature studios which was built by the original producer of the game Greg Johnson. Going to kickstarted to get this game funded, the game had a successful kickstarter and now teamed up with Adult Swim Games to get it published. The game features the familiar duo ToeJam & Earl who are self proclaimed rap master teenagers who are once again trapped on earth and need to find a way to get back home. Most of the gameplay remains the same "Rogue-Like" RPG style that it was known for before changing is direction with the other two sequels. More features has been added this time around with new playable characters and some returning features.
